The devmem TCP requires the hds-thresh value to be 0, but it doesn't
change it automatically.
Therefore, configure_hds_thresh() is added to handle this.

The run_devmem_tests() now tests hds_thresh, but it skips test if the
hds_thresh_max value is 0.
